Archiving Cold Storage Buckets — Recovery Notes

Before each quarterly release, the Glacierline buckets holding retired build artifacts must be archived by the release manager. Run the archive job from the Fennwick bastion, verify checksums against the manifest, then lock the bucket policy to read-only. If the archive service account is locked out mid-run, initiate account recovery through the Tallowgate console. The recovery flow will prompt for the standby passphrase, which is recorded below for this rotation.

unlock words, hahip-yagef: zorok-novmir-zorix-silax

Ticket: Stitchline clients drop websocket connections on idle and the reconnect handler loops with zero backoff, hammering the Corvass gateway. Observed after the v3 handshake change. Proposed fix adds jittered exponential backoff capped at 60s. Recommend holding the release train until this lands. The reproducing build's trace token is below.

trace token, fafog-kageg: htk4_98e6

From the front desk, Ambervale Tower — for the attention of the night shift. Please note the evacuation-chair store on level 2, beside the west stairwell, has been re-keyed following last month's inspection by our safety officer, Rhona Bellis. The chairs inside were serviced and tagged; do not remove them except during a drill or genuine evacuation, and record any use in the red logbook on the shelf. The old key no longer works. To open the store cupboard, the panel now accepts the following.

door code, bagef-yafop: bdg-ZFZML-07646